Lamb with Spinach Bulgur

Prep: 15min
| Servings: 4 | Cook: 20min

Ingredients

  • 500 ml vegetable broth
  • 250 g bulgur
  • 2 tbsp Tomato paste
  • 0.5 tsp cumin
  • 400 g spinach
  • 2 tbsp chopped parsley
  • 600 g lamb loin fillet
  • Salt
  • Pepper (freshly ground)
  • 2 tbsp oil
  • 300 g yogurt
  • spinach leaves (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. 1.

    Bring broth to a boil, add bulgur, tomato paste and cumin, cover and simmer for about 15 minutes until the bulgur is cooked.

  2. 2.

    Wash spinach, drain, and roughly chop.

  3. 3.

    Rinse lamb fillet, pat dry, season. In hot oil brown all sides for about 8 minutes; wrap in foil and rest.

  4. 4.

    Sauté spinach in the pan fat, let it wilt, season with salt and pepper, then mix with the bulgur.

  5. 5.

    Whisk yogurt and parsley together, season with salt and pepper.

  6. 6.

    Slice lamb and arrange over the bulgur mixture, garnish with spinach leaves, and serve with the yogurt sauce.
